How We Value Silver Buffalo Rounds
Silver Buffalo rounds are valued first on their metal. Each standard round holds one troy ounce of .999 fine silver, and many newer rounds are struck in .9999 purity. We weigh every piece on a calibrated scale and read the purity stamped on the metal, so your offer rests on real, measurable silver content and the live silver market on the day you visit.
It helps to understand what these rounds are. Silver Buffalos are privately minted bullion, not coins from the U.S. Mint, and they carry no face value. Because the design is so widely recognized, they stay highly liquid and trade close to the silver market, which keeps the math simple. They sell alongside American Silver Eagles and other silver bars and bullion, and we appraise all of it together.
Authentication matters, and it is where a real dealer protects you. A genuine 1 oz Silver Buffalo round measures roughly 39 mm across, about 2.5 mm thick, and weighs 31.1 grams. We check dimensions, weight, and the ring of the metal to screen out plated fakes and underweight copies. Fractional 1/10, 1/4, and 1/2 oz rounds and heavier 5 oz rounds are each judged on their own weight and purity, so no ounce of your silver goes unaccounted for.

A Silver Buffalo round is privately minted .999 silver bullion with no face value, inspired by the 1913 Buffalo Nickel. The Gold American Buffalo is a legal-tender gold coin from the U.S. Mint. We buy both, plus Silver Eagles and other bullion, at our Lawndale store.
No. Unlike government-issued coins, Silver Buffalo rounds are produced by private mints and carry no legal-tender face value. Their worth is tied entirely to the silver they contain. This actually makes them easy to sell, since the value rests on weight and purity rather than a collectible denomination.
